In order to use software to control your radio, you will need to provide a hardware connection between the radio and your computer. The policy is to support Windows versions which are supported by Microsoft.Īny licensed Amateur may download, install, and use HRD. It may work with Windows 98 but this is not supported.

It is designed for Windows 2000 or higher (XP, Vista, 7), also Internet Explorer 6.0 (or higher) is required. Ham Radio Deluxe (HRD) also includes mapping, satellite tracking and the digital mode program Digital Master 780 (DM780). Ham Radio Deluxe is a free software suite written by Simon Brown, HB9DRV.
